Conductor Termination Apparatus And Method

US Patent:
7052323, May 30, 2006
Filed:
Oct 30, 2002
Appl. No.:
10/285020
Inventors:
Brian F. Ruff - Lee's Summit MO, US
Walter J. Rolston - Overland Park KS, US
Greg A. January - Shawnee KS, US
Assignee:
Garmin, Ltd. - George Town
International Classification:
H01R 13/66
US Classification:
439620, 439696
Abstract:
In one embodiment, an apparatus is provided which includes a connector backshell, a conductor clamp, and a thermocouple attachment point. In another embodiment, an apparatus is provided which includes a connector backshell, a cover, a connector, a conductor clamp, and a thermocouple attachment point. A method of assembling a connector housing includes laying a plurality of unshielded conductor portions against a backshell support and clamping the plurality of unshielded conductor portions against the support. The method can also include attaching a thermocouple to a thermocouple attachment point on the backshell.

Adjustable Flotation Device

US Patent:
2020035, Nov 12, 2020
Filed:
May 5, 2020
Appl. No.:
16/866948
Inventors:
Greg A. January - Shawnee KS, US
International Classification:
B63B 34/50
Abstract:
A flotation device includes a main body portion having a leg rest, seat, back rest, and headrest. Arms are adjustably attached to the back rest via hinge mechanisms which allow the arms to be pivoted towards and away from the main body portion, and which allow the length of the arms' extension from the main body portion to be adjusted. In alternative embodiments, cupholders are secured in apertures in the arms, with headrest extensions providing additional buoyance to the head rest portion.
